Troubleshooting

Mattress not fully expanding

Ensure the mattress has been out of its packaging for at least 48 hours in a room with a stable temperature. Check for any obstructions preventing full expansion.

Initial odor upon unpacking

This is normal for new foam products. Allow the mattress to air out in a well-ventilated room for 48-72 hours. The odor should dissipate.

Noticeable sagging or dipping

Ensure the mattress is on a properly supportive bed frame. Rotate the mattress head-to-foot. If sagging persists and is significant, contact customer support regarding the warranty.

Feeling too warm during sleep

The knitted fabric is designed for breathability. Consider using breathable bedding or a mattress protector with cooling properties. Ensure the room is well-ventilated.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

Setup: Upon delivery, carefully unroll or unwrap the mattress according to the manufacturer's instructions. Allow the mattress to decompress and expand fully to its intended size for at least 24-48 hours in a well-ventilated room before use.

Compatibility: This mattress is compatible with most standard bed frames, including slatted bases, divan bases, and adjustable bed bases. Ensure your bed frame provides adequate support, with slats spaced no more than 2-3 inches apart, to prevent sagging and maintain mattress integrity.

Care: To maintain hygiene and prolong the life of your mattress:

  • Rotate the mattress head-to-foot every 3-6 months.
  • Use a mattress protector at all times to guard against spills and stains.
  • Vacuum the mattress surface gently with an upholstery attachment if needed.
  • Spot clean any minor stains with a mild detergent and a damp cloth. Do not saturate the mattress with water. Allow to air dry completely.
  • Avoid jumping or standing on the mattress.
